Royal Challengers Bangalore sealed their spot in the IPL 2025 final with an emphatic 8-wicket win over Punjab Kings in Qualifier-1, marking their fourth appearance in the title clash. After 18 long years and three missed chances, Virat Kohli and RCB look hungrier than ever to finally lift the coveted trophy.

As soon as the victory was confirmed, Kohli was seen making a heartfelt gesture to his wife Anushka Sharma—holding up one finger, signaling "just one more step to go." Anushka’s joyful leap captured hearts on social media, symbolizing the hope and excitement of RCB’s fans everywhere.

Despite a modest 12 runs from Kohli in this match, his energy and leadership on the field were palpable, setting fields and motivating bowlers. The bowling attack was clinical, restricting Punjab to just 101 runs in 14.1 overs. Josh Hazlewood led with 3 wickets for 21 runs, supported by Yash Dayal, Bhuvneshwar Kumar, and Suyash Sharma’s combined efforts.

RCB chased down the target swiftly in 10 overs with only 2 wickets lost, setting the stage for a thrilling final. After years of waiting, the Bangalore team and their iconic captain are finally on the cusp of IPL glory.
